Transaction 3bcf596fd5f63a53523882ab0d9561459fd3afc1a30e273dfd112aaf1bfe8f2b
1 Input
1 Output
-
3bcf596fd5f63a53523882ab0d9561459fd3afc1a30e273dfd112aaf1bfe8f2b:0
- value
- 74213460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de785e95f27b391839a8a92b68d47f1a146a1428 OP_EQUAL
- address
- 3MyL8YjLpUAvqE8ScdLg5hAmMSFiYgSWm9